We’ve all heard ‘relationships are hard.’ And while that can be true, it doesn’t have to feel impossible. If you’re stuck in the same fights, drifting toward feeling like roommates, or just unsure if you’re still in it, couples support gives you space to hit pause, be honest, and see what’s really happening.
I draw from Gottman and EFT-informed approaches to help couples stop the blame game, take a clear look at their relationship, and decide what comes next—whether that’s deepening your connection or moving forward with clarity, courage, and compassion.

After the excitement of engagement and wedding planning, comes real life — and with it, the opportunity to build a strong, lasting partnership. My approach to premarital work is secular, inclusive, and LGBTQ+ affirming, designed to support all couples in laying a solid foundation for the road ahead.
Using the Gottman Method, we’ll dig into what really matters, build practical tools for communication and conflict, and create a partnership that can weather the real stuff — together.

Hi, I’m Kate!
I’m a Licensed Clinical Social Worker (LCSW) and trained coaching professional based in Whitefish, Montana, and I work with individuals and couples who feel stuck, disconnected, overwhelmed, or tired of pretending everything is “fine.”
In our work together, you’ll have a space to be fully seen and heard, imperfections, contradictions, and all. My approach is warm, practical, and deeply human, with no pretense or judgment, just support for the work you want to do. Whether you’re here to process your own experiences, build clarity and acceptance, or strengthen your connection with a partner, we’ll focus on what matters most to you at a pace that feels right.
I draw from evidence-based approaches like the Gottman Method, Emotionally Focused Therapy (EFT), Internal Family Systems (IFS), mindfulness, DBT, and ACT, but more than any method, our work is about what actually helps you.
